How they compare

UNICEF: East Asia and the Pacific Programme Countries currently reports 0.88 GPIA against 0.6683 GPIA in Namibia, a difference of 0.2117 GPIA.

That makes UNICEF: East Asia and the Pacific Programme Countries's figure about 1.3 times Namibia's.

Across all 8 years both countries report, UNICEF: East Asia and the Pacific Programme Countries has been ahead every year.

Namibia ranks 75th and UNICEF: East Asia and the Pacific Programme Countries ranks 76th of 119 countries.

UNICEF: East Asia and the Pacific Programme Countries has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
